The Raptors prolong their streak and ascend to the second position of the East

MADRID, 25 Jan. (EUROPA PRESS) –

Toronto Raptors has sealed its sixth consecutive victory this morning after beating New York Knicks (112-118) to storm the second place of the Eastern Conference, in an early morning in which they also beat the Phoenix Suns of Ricky Rubio to San Antonio Spurs ( 99-103) and the Denver Nuggets of Juancho Hernangómez to New Orleans Pelicans (106-113), while Willy and his Hornets fell to the Bucks in Paris (103-116).

In Madison Square Garden, the Canadians matched the Miami Heat brand (31-14) to snatch the second position, although far from some Milwaukee Bucks that continue to dominate with solvency in the East (40-6). Base Kyle Lowry and Cameroonian power forward Pascal Siakam, with 26 and 23 points respectively, led the Raptors attack.

The power forward Marc Gasol, who spent more than half an hour on the track, contributed 6 points, 9 rebounds and 4 assists, while the Spanish-Congolese power forward Serge Ibaka scored 14 points and put 2 blocks in his almost 20 minutes of participation.

For their part, the Suns interrupted a streak of two consecutive losses by beating a direct rival for the 'playoffs', San Antonio, commanded by the 35 goals of their guard Devin Booker. The base Ricky Rubio helped the triumph of the Arizona (19-26) with 11 points, 2 rebounds and 2 assists in 35 minutes.

Juancho Hernangómez, the Madrid power forward, also won 4 minutes in which he signed 1 rebound, 1 assist and 1 steal, in New Orleans, in a duel in which Colorado (31-14) took hold fourth from West.

Finally, the Charlotte Hornets of Willy Hernangómez suffered their seventh straight defeat in the match they played against the Bucks at the AccorHotels Arena in Paris. The Madrid had just under eight minutes of participation and achieved 3 points, 1 rebound and 1 assist.
